The team here at CCUI 13 has been working in our spare time to investigate the 2002 Cold Case Murder of Nancy Lyons of Carthage, IN. We’ve read through publicly available case notes, YouTube videos, online forums, court documents, police reports, logs, reports, and interviews.
Our goal is to get the word out about her case and tell a story about what we’ve uncovered up to this point. We hope to see someday that justice is served for Nancy.
